1.0 GENERAL DESCRIPTION
1.1 Introduction
HannStar Display model HSD170PGW1-A is a color active matrix thin film transistor
(TFT)liquid crystal display(LCD) that uses amorphous silicon TFT as a switching
device. This model is composed of a TFT LCD panel, a driving circuit and a back light
system. This TFT LCD has a 17.0 inch diagonally measured active display area with
XGA resolution (900 vertical by 1440 horizontal pixel array) and can display up to
262,144 colors.

6.2 Back-Light Unit
The back-light system is an edge-lighting type with 1 CCFL(Cold Cathode Fluorescent Lamp).
The characteristics of the lamp is shown in the following tables.

Note (2) Lamp frequency may produce interference with horizontal synchronous
frequency and this may cause ripple noise on the display. Therefore lamp
frequency shall be kept away from the horizontal synchronous frequency
and its harmonics as far as possible in order to avoid interference.
*
Suggest the inverter frequency avoid fL=51~59KHz
Note (3) Lamp life time (Hr) can be defined as the time in which it continues to
operate under the condition : Ta=25±3 oC, typical IL value indicated in the
above table and fL=52kHz until the brightness becomes less than 50%.
Note (4) CCFL inverter should be able to provide a voltage over specified
value (Vs) in the above table. Lamp units need at least Vs value
shown above to ignition.
Note (5) The voltage over specified value (Vs) should be applied to the lamp more
than 1 second after startup. Otherwise, the lamp may not be turned on. The
used lamp current is the lamp typical current.

Note (6) The output voltage waveform and current waveform of the inverter must be
symmetrical (Unsymmetrical ratio is less than 10%). Please do not use the
inverter which has unsymmetrical voltage and current waveform, and spike
waveform. The inverter design which can provide the best optical
performance, power efficiency, and lamp life should under the following
conditions.
a. The asymmetry rate of the inverter waveform should be less than 10%.
b. The distortion tae of the waveform should be within √2±10%.
c. The inverter output waveform should be better similar to the ideal sine wave.
Ip
I-p
Asymmetry rate = |Ip-I-p| / Irms x 100%
Distortion rate = Ip (or I-p) / Irms

10.0 GENERAL PRECAUTION
10.1 Use Restriction
This product is not authorized for use in life supporting systems, aircraft navigation
control systems, military systems and any other application where performance
failure could be life-threatening or otherwise catastrophic.
10.2 Disassembling or Modification
Do not disassemble or modify the module. It may damage sensitive parts inside
LCD module, and may cause scratches or dust on the display. HannStar does not
warrant the module, if customers disassemble or modify the module.
10.3 Breakage of LCD Panel
10.3.1 If LCD panel is broken and liquid crystal spills out, do not ingest or inhale liquid
crystal, and do not contact liquid crystal with skin.
10.3.2 If liquid crystal contacts mouth or eyes, rinse out with water immediately.
10.3.3 If liquid crystal contacts skin or cloths, wash it off immediately with alcohol and
rinse thoroughly with water.
10.3.4 Handle carefully with chips of glass that may cause injury, when the glass is
broken.
10.4 Electric Shock
10.4.1 Disconnect power supply before handling LCD module.
10.4.2 Do not pull or fold the CCFL cable.
10.4.3 Do not touch the parts inside LCD modules and the fluorescent lamp’s
connector or cables in order to prevent electric shock.
10.5 Absolute Maximum Ratings and Power Protection Circuit
10.5.1 Do not exceed the absolute maximum rating values, such as the supply voltage
variation, input voltage variation, variation in parts’ parameters, environmental
temperature, etc., otherwise LCD module may be damaged.
10.5.2 Please do not leave LCD module in the environment of high humidity and high
temperature for a long time.
10.5.3 It’s recommended to employ protection circuit for power supply.
10.6 Operation
10.6.1 Do not touch, push or rub the polarizer with anything harder than HB pencil
lead.
10.6.2 Use fingerstalls of soft gloves in order to keep clean display quality, when
persons handle the LCD module for incoming inspection or assembly.
10.6.3 When the surface is dusty, please wipe gently with absorbent cotton or other
soft material.

10.6.4 Wipe off saliva or water drops as soon as possible. If saliva or water drops contact
with polarizer for a long time, they may causes deformation or color fading.
10.6.5 When cleaning the adhesives, please use absorbent cotton wetted with a little
petroleum benzine or other adequate solvent.
10.7 Mechanism
Please mount LCD module by using mouting holes arranged in four cornerstightly.
10.8 Static Electricity
10.8.1 Protection film must remove very slowly from the surface of LCD module to prevent
from electrostatic occurrence.
10.8.2 Because LCD module use CMOS-IC on circuit board and TFT-LCD panel, it is very
weak to electrostatic discharge. Please be careful with electrostatic discharge.
Persons who handle the module should be grounded through adequate methods.
10.9 Strong Light Exposure
The module shall not be exposed under strong light such as direct sunlight. Otherwise,
display characteristics may be changed.
10.10 Disposal
When disposing LCD module, obey the local environmental regulations.
